Mpox Long-Term Symptoms: 58% Report Lasting Effects

0 comments

A staggering 58% of individuals infected during the 2022 mpox outbreak continue to grapple with persistent physical symptoms months, and in some cases, over a year after initial infection. This isn’t simply a case of the rash fading and life returning to normal. Emerging research paints a picture of a potentially chronic condition, demanding a fundamental shift in how we understand and manage mpox – and prepare for future viral threats.

The Spectrum of Long Mpox: Beyond Skin Deep

Initial reports focused understandably on the characteristic rash. However, the latest studies, as highlighted by respiratory-therapy.com, ABC News, Gavi, the Vaccine Alliance, indianewsnetwork.com, and Scimex, reveal a far more complex and concerning reality. **Long mpox**, as it’s increasingly being termed, manifests in a diverse range of lingering health issues. These include persistent pain, fatigue, cognitive dysfunction (“brain fog”), and even neurological complications. The breadth of these symptoms suggests mpox may not simply be a self-limiting infection, but a trigger for chronic health problems.

Understanding the Underlying Mechanisms

The precise mechanisms driving these long-term effects remain under investigation. Several theories are gaining traction. One posits that the virus causes persistent inflammation, even after viral clearance. Another suggests that mpox may disrupt the microbiome, leading to downstream health consequences. A third, and perhaps most alarming, possibility is that the virus causes subtle but significant damage to organs, which only becomes apparent over time. Further research, including longitudinal studies tracking patients for years to come, is crucial to unraveling these complexities.

Frequently Asked Questions About Long Mpox

What is the current understanding of the long-term neurological effects of mpox?

Research suggests that mpox can, in some cases, lead to neurological complications such as cognitive dysfunction (“brain fog”), headaches, and even more serious issues like encephalitis. The exact mechanisms are still being investigated, but inflammation and potential viral persistence in the nervous system are suspected.

How does the mpox vaccine (JYNNEOS) impact the risk of developing long mpox?

While the JYNNEOS vaccine is highly effective at preventing the initial mpox infection and severe illness, its impact on reducing the risk of long mpox is still being studied. Early data suggests vaccination may lessen the severity of symptoms and potentially reduce the likelihood of long-term complications, but more research is needed.
